The land scam involving Parth Pawar in Koregaon Park has caused a stir in the state. Ajit Pawar's son, Parth Pawar, through his Amedia Enterprises company, is alleged to have purchased land worth 1800 crores for just 300 crores.

Many revelations are coming to light on this. Against this backdrop, a report on Parth Pawar's land scam in Pune is expected today.

This report will be presented today at the Inspector General of Registration's office, with Deputy Inspector General of Registration and Inquiry Committee Chairman Rajendra Muthe presenting the report. It is reported that the facts related to the scam have been presented in this report.
